The History Behind the Flag
The tradition of presenting a flag at a funeral dates back to the Civil War era, when it was used to honor fallen soldiers. Over time, the practice has evolved to include not just military personnel, but also first responders and other public servants who have made the ultimate sacrifice. It's a powerful symbol of respect and gratitude, and it's a beautiful way to pay tribute to those who have given their lives in service to others.
A Symbol of Honor
So, what exactly happens during a flag presentation at a funeral? Well, typically, a member of the military or a representative from a veteran's organization will present the flag to the family of the deceased, often with a formal ceremony and words of condolence.
